Since your blaster is stock i don't think you have a big bore installed. The only way to no for sure is to take just the head off and measure the piston.
If it is 66mm across it is stock if it is 72mm across it has the big bore installed. All it will cost you to find out is a head gasket and about 30 min. time.Don't forget to torque the head bolts to 20 ft.lbs. in a criss cross pattern. let us no what you find out. Or if you need help.
 
I just ordered my Barnett Dirt Digger clutch...It uses Kevlar on the plates which make them engage alot better...I ended up paying $120 shipped which isnt too bad considering all the money I spent on my off-road veichle. I also ordered a Hinson clutch basket because I heard if you run the Dirt Digger clutch and stock clutch basket, that it can strip the stock basket by gripping so hard.
